Buyer (Manufacturing)

Location: West Midlands

Salary: Competitive + Holidays + Bank Holidays + Pension Scheme + Training & Development + Company Benefits + Company Events

About the Role

We are seeking an experienced Buyer, Supply Chain, Procurement, or Purchasing Specialist to join a well-established manufacturing company known for quality. Enjoy working in a progressive environment that values training, development, and career progression.

Key Responsibilities
  1. Sourcing and purchasing materials and services to meet quality, budget, and delivery expectations.
  2. Managing end-to-end supply chain functions.
  3. Building and maintaining strong supplier relationships.
  4. Negotiating terms and prices with suppliers, reviewing performance, and reducing costs.
  5. Ensuring all purchases comply with ISO 9001 and 14001 standards.
  6. Stock management and materials control.
  7. Coordinating global shipments with the import team and third-party logistics providers.
Candidate Requirements
  1. Experience as a buyer, supply chain, purchasing, or procurement professional within manufacturing.
  2. Familiarity with ERP systems.
  3. Ideally, working towards or holding MCIPS qualifications.
  4. Knowledge of ISO 9001 and 14001 standards.
Working Conditions

Monday to Friday, dayshift.
